## EXIF Scrubbing: Quick Checks

If a customer reports location data showing up on uploaded photos, the Tinplate scrubber probably skipped the file — usually because it exceeded the size cap or hit an unsupported format. Don't promise a fix on the call; just file it to the Gallery team. First, confirm the scrubber is running with the standard settings shown here.

deployment values, yadug-bawif:
[framir]
team = pelox
access_code = ac_a38ab2
owner = tamion.julael
host = framir.tolvaqlabs.test
port = 11211
peer = tammir.zemvargrid.local
salt = 2215ef03
pin = 1541

CHANGELOG — Driftwatch v2.3.0

Renamed setting: DW_POLL_SECRET is now DW_DRIFT_AUTH. New team members: Driftwatch compares cron fire times against the Loomfield reference clock, and the collector authenticates each drift sample it submits. The old name is still read with a deprecation warning until v2.5, but please migrate your env files now. Update /etc/driftwatch/collector.env, remove the legacy entry, and place the renamed credential on the very next line.

sealed setting: ARCHIVE_KEY3=8d0

**Q: How does the Marlowe Catalogue import handle untrusted MARC files?**

All uploads to the Thornfield Library system pass through a sandboxed parser before any records touch the staging database. Fields exceeding declared lengths are truncated and logged, and embedded scripts in note fields are stripped outright. Import jobs run under a service account with write access limited to the staging schema only. Full audit trails are retained for ninety days. For the current threat model document, reach out below.

billing contact of yawip-yadup = druath.casdor@nelvrolabs.internal

Handover: charset sniffing in Textgrove

Hey Marek — before you review the branch, some context. Textgrove's encoding detection for uploaded text files now runs a two-pass sniff: byte-order marks first, then a statistical pass using the Ferndale tables. The old heuristic mislabeled Turkish and Czech files constantly, hence the rewrite. Mixed-encoding files fall back to a configurable default rather than erroring. The detector reads its thresholds from the settings pasted below.

config for kaguf-tahop:
fenir:
  pin: 0174
  tenant: novix
  seal: seal_58ebeb9f
  metrics_host: metrics.fenir.halixsoft.corp
  standby_team: gilys
  escalation: weniel-feniel
  nonce: 50fe55